Michael "Marcus" Johnson (born December 1, 1981) is an American college football coach and former professional player who was a guard in the National Football League (NFL). He played college football for the Ole Miss Rebels and was selected by the Minnesota Vikings in the second round of the 2005 NFL draft.[1]
Johnson was also a member of the Oakland Raiders, Tampa Bay Buccaneers and Hartford Colonials. He is the younger brother of CFL offensive lineman Belton Johnson.
